    SHN and Ohana each had six Gigaton songs - four in common (SBWM, DOTC, Quick Escape and Seven O’Clock) and two unique (Never Destination and Take The Long Way for SHN, Retrograde and Alright for Ohana). That leaves four songs (Who Ever Said, Buckle Up, Comes Then Goes and River Cross) unplayed so far. 

    I’d guess that that each night of the Encore gets the four “common” songs and two of the remainders. If I were going to one I’d be hoping for Who Ever Said and River Cross.
